Latest Patents

Neumann's latest patents focus on processes and agents for detecting Listeria bacteria, specifically L. monocytogenes. These inventions include agents that utilize primers selected from the iap gene of L. monocytogenes. Additionally, his patents feature peptides derived from the p60 protein, which are designed to produce specific antibodies for the immunological detection of L. monocytogenes. This innovative approach enhances the accuracy and efficiency of bacterial detection methods.
